Summary

The talk is organized in roughly three parts:
The first part is an introduction to the concepts of Cloud Computing. What the cloud is, Software-, Platform-, Infrastructure-as-a-Service, and the X-as-a-Service trend. The technologies behind the cloud and how the evolution of virtualization made the Cloud possible. At this point, we will talk about using the cloud as an application developer, and discuss the shift from monolithic applications running on heavy servers to the vision of distributed, "cloud-native" applications running as a set of independent micro-services.
In the second part, the talk moves to the process of implementing a cloud, focusing on Infrastructure-as-a-Service clouds. It presents briefly the three main pillars in delivering IaaS, Compute, Networking and Storage, using two open source cloud implementations -- OpenStack and Synnefo -- as case studies. We compare their architecture, and highlight the main design decisions that influenced each approach. We focus on the challenges in developing scalable, distributed data systems, the tradeoff between consistency and scalability, and the role of transactional (non-) guarantees.
Finally, the third part focuses on Storage. We discuss the importance of the storage layer in achieving performance and reliability in the cloud, examine Ceph, a well-known open source storage system, and discuss the biggest challenges with delivering advanced functionality while scaling beyond a single datacenter.
Speaker Bio:


Vangelis Koukis is Founder & CTO of Arrikto, a stealth-mode startup building the next generation of storage intelligence, unifying the way to access, manage, and store data in large-scale, heterogeneous and hybrid environments.
Prior to co-founding Arrikto, he worked with GRNET as the Technical Lead of the team which undertook the task of building GRNET's large-scale public IaaS cloud service, ~okeanos. The software powering the service, Synnefo, grew into a separate open source project, used to power a number of clouds today both in academic institutions and in the industry.
